Comparing Automation Platforms: A Deep Dive into ABB, Schneider Electric, Rockwell Automation, and Siemens

The automation industry is rapidly progressing, with leading players like ABB, Schneider Electric, Rockwell Automation, and Siemens offering a wide range of innovative solutions. Choosing the right platform for your specific needs can be complex. This article delves into these prominent automation platforms, highlighting their key features, strengths, and weaknesses to help you make an informed decision.

Each of these companies has a respected track record in the automation industry, having expertise in various domains. ABB is known for its robotics, while Schneider Electric specializes in energy management. Rockwell Automation specializes on industrial control and automation, and Siemens offers a extensive portfolio of automation technologies.

  • Evaluate your specific requirements, including the type of applications you need to automate, scalability needs, budget constraints, and current systems.
  • Investigate each platform's features, capabilities, and compatibility with your hardware.
  • Consult experts and industry professionals to gain practical knowledge.
